Abstract
In an APT method, the surface-contact electrodes are located in a closed loop or rosette array on one planar, or nominally planar, skin surface of a body to be investigated, and electrically connected to data acquisition and processing equipment. The invention also includes apparatus for carrying out this method, comprising an array of surface-contact electrodes (8), adapted to be applied to the skin of a body to be investigated, the electrodes (8) being arranged on a flexible carrier (10) in a closed loop, or rosette formation on one common plane, or nominal plane.

- 2. Apparatus for use in investigating a region within a body by applied potential tomography, comprising a plurality of surface-contact electrodes arranged on a common flexible carrier applicable to a substantially planar skin area of the body to be investigated, to locate said electrodes in a closed loop array surrounding a generally electrode-free area on the skin area.
